				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>&#8220;When we began to design our component for the vertical installation, we initially experimented with a variation of shapes, some were space filling, while others were more design oriented. As we began to refine our conceptual model, we realized that it was essential to take into account the structural support of the central pipe, as well as the connection points. While the top and bottom points could easily be connected using a series of straight lines in Rhino, through the use of Grasshopper the model was able to develop into a more complex shape. The original lines became piped curves along a lofted mesh that allowed for a more dynamic representation of the basic connections. These curves intersect each other throughout the model to ensure more structural stability. We also added a few more pipes in the middle and the top of the model to allow for additional support.&#8221;

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div>The initial idea evolved from metal studs on jackets representing the undying age of Rock n’ Roll. The square pyramid unit was altered into an off-centered triangular pyramid to achieve more permutations of arrangement. The units are equilateral triangles with grove for wide end flanges (located at center of each sides). This allows for random arrangement of the blocks without any set rules. As demonstrated through the images,</div>
<div>the triangles can be slided over one another with the help of slide-in dowels freely in any permutation. Also, the joinery helps to support the unit from all side, also allowing for omission of blocks to create openings in the wall The idea was to demonstrate use of a very simple unit that can be repeated to get various altering patterns. This projects the wall made of random complex geometry and eliminates the existence of single units. Thus, giving a continuous pattern of prisms.</div>
